Are there guided tours with electric scooter rentals to explore Mallorca's towns and beaches?

Renting an electric scooter paired with a guided tour offers a flexible and exciting way to explore both the bustling streets and scenic coastline here. Many operators based near Palma or along the Ma-13 road arrange tours that combine scooter rentals with knowledgeable guides who lead visitors through highlights such as the Serra de Tramuntana villages or the stunning coves of Cala Mondrago and Cala Llombards. These tours typically cover a comfortable distance that would be too long to hike but ideal to zip through at scooter speed without fatigue.

Before setting off, you'll usually receive a brief orientation about local traffic rules and scooter handling, along with safety gear like helmets. This ensures everyone feels confident navigating Mallorca's mix of urban roads and country lanes. Guided scooter tours allow you to reach special spots like Valldemossa's historic streets or the cliffs around Formentor, where parking or public transport access can be tricky.

Traveling this way offers a fresh perspective on the island’s varied landscape—from the vineyards of Binissalem to the beaches near Alcudia. Guides also enrich the route with history and local lore, sharing details about traditional dishes like pa amb oli and the spirited nightlife during festivals such as Nit de Foc. For those wanting to explore off the beaten path yet still enjoy expert insights, these scooter tours balance adventure, culture, and comfort beautifully.
